Flatpak (formerly xdg-app) is a distro-agnostic application framework. It is a decentralized system and has no central package repository. Instead, the user must manually add the repository's URL to the system before packages can be installed, like in [[Emulation on Ubuntu|Ubuntu's PPA]].
[https://flathub.org/ Flathub], is probably the biggest Flatpak repository, has several and quite a few emulators.
